What it actually is

AEO is not a new ranking game.

Answer engines do not rank ten blue links. They read sources, extract facts and compose an answer. Whether you appear depends on whether your page states its facts in a form a machine can lift — the product, the price, the terms, the answers to obvious questions.

That is the honest version. Anyone selling you an AEO ranking factor is guessing: no vendor publishes how sources are picked, and nobody has reliable comparative data. What can be measured is whether your page is technically readable at all — and that part is not guesswork.

The four levers

What actually moves.

  1. 1

    Access

    Your robots.txt decides which AI crawlers may read you at all — GPTBot, ClaudeBot, PerplexityBot, Google-Extended and others. Many sites block them by accident, or allow none of them and wonder about the silence.

  2. 2

    Structured facts

    JSON-LD is the only place where your page states unambiguously what it offers and what it costs. A price that only exists as styled text is invisible to a model comparing vendors.

  3. 3

    A summary you wrote

    llms.txt gives a model a short, authored description of your site instead of leaving it to infer one from your navigation. Not a ratified standard — cheap to add, see the dedicated page.

  4. 4

    Being distinguishable

    If every page carries the same title and description, a model cannot tell your pricing page from your imprint. This is the most common finding we see, and the most damaging.

Questions

Does AEO replace SEO?
No. A page that search engines cannot index is not a source for an answer engine either. AEO comes on top of the basics, it does not replace them.
Can you get me into ChatGPT answers?
Nobody can promise that, and we do not. We check whether your site is technically readable and complete. Whether a model picks you as a source is its decision, not a setting.
Should I block AI crawlers instead?
That is a legitimate choice — but it is a decision, not a default. We show you which crawlers you currently admit and which you block, so the state of your robots.txt matches what you intended.
Is this measurable at all?
The technical side is: markup is either present and valid or it is not. The outcome — being quoted more often — is not something we or anyone else can measure reliably today, and we will not claim otherwise.
